How much do trade show man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for trade show manager in Midvale, UT is $63,329.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$47,600.00 and $76,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a trade show manager?

As a trade show manager, you oversee all the logistics of a trade show or similar event. Your responsibilities are to coordinate the event, provide booth assignments to attendees, plan the technical aspects of special events or presentations, develop the master schedule for the event, promote the event through local or national media, help attendees install and tear down their booths after the event, and report on the event. Many trade show managers work as part of a convention center team and put on dozens of conventions or events throughout the year. Others may work for a specific organization or one-off event.

What are some common challenges faced by trade show managers, and how can they be effectively addressed?

Trade Show Managers often encounter challenges such as coordinating multiple vendors, managing tight deadlines, and ensuring all logistics run smoothly on event days. Communication is key—proactively updating stakeholders and having contingency plans in place can help mitigate last-minute issues. Building strong relationships with reliable suppliers and keeping detailed checklists can also streamline operations, making it easier to adapt to unexpected changes or requests. Staying organized and prioritizing tasks are essential skills for navigating the fast-paced environment typical of this role.

What is the difference between Trade Show Manager vs Event Coordinator?

AspectTrade Show ManagerEvent Coordinator
Primary FocusPlanning and managing trade shows and exhibitionsOrganizing various types of events like conferences, weddings, corporate events
Work EnvironmentTrade show venues, exhibition halls, trade centersEvent venues, conference centers, outdoor locations
Required CredentialsExperience in event planning, industry-specific knowledge, sometimes certifications like CMPEvent planning experience, organizational skills, sometimes certifications
Industry UsageCommonly employed in trade, manufacturing, and sales industriesUsed across diverse industries including corporate, nonprofit, hospitality

While both roles involve event planning, a Trade Show Manager specializes in managing trade shows and exhibitions within specific industries, focusing on booth design, logistics, and industry networking. An Event Coordinator handles a broader range of events, including social and corporate functions, with a wider scope of responsibilities.
